Zulkifli Bin Mohd Dahlan is a self-taught artist and a member of Anak Alam, a collective of young, socially-engaged Malaysian artists who promulgated a multi-disciplinary practice and produced works across the visual arts, spoken word, poetry and theatre in the 1970s. During the mid-1970s, Zulkifli produced some of his best-known works: Kedai-Kedai (Shops, 1973) and Realiti Berasingan: Satu Hari di Bumi Larangan (Separate Reality: One Day in the Forbidden Land, 1975) although majority of his works are in ink on paper. Dari Dalam Sa-buah Rumah (From Inside the House) is executed in bright enamel paint and ink on a broad plywood surface, depicting nude figures in the interior of a domicile. The perspective of the figures, furniture and walls in the space is rendered flat with no illusion of receding space. This work is one of five paintings submitted by Zulkifli Dahlan for the inaugural Bakat Muda Sezaman (Young Contemporaries) competition organized by the National Art Gallery, Kuala Lumpur in 1974 which he won the Best Artist award.
